Relative Search:
Baidu Google
Edit this listing

USA Automotive Systems Inc

2630 W 81st Ave
Merrillville , IN 46410
219-769-6545
Category

Driving Directions

From:
To: 2630 W 81st Ave ,Merrillville , IN 46410